How Kleanland Electrostatic Precipitators assist lessen Airborne Particles in Textile production

The textile dyeing and ending approach generates considerable quantities of oil-bearing fumes and natural and organic compounds, which include textile auxiliaries. These fumes can access densities of as much as 80mg/m3, posing major wellbeing pitfalls to staff and contributing to air pollution. Kleanland esp hire advanced electrostatic precipitation technology to seize and take away these airborne particles successfully. By building an electrostatic cost, the ESP draws in and collects even the smallest particles, making sure the air produced from textile factories is appreciably cleaner. This not merely assists defend the atmosphere and also results in a safer Operating ecosystem for workers.

Why Electrostatic Precipitators Are Essential for Controlling Emissions in Textile Processing crops

Electrostatic precipitators, specifically those developed by Kleanland, are essential for managing emissions in textile processing plants. These vegetation generally cope with various pollutants, such as natural oils, dyes, dye auxiliaries, lubricant oils, and fiber particles. regular air filtration devices struggle to manage this kind of a various range of contaminants effectively. even so, the State-of-the-art ESP engineering utilized by Kleanland captures these pollutants with superior performance. by making use of a combination of h2o scrubbers, dual-drive huge spacing esp, and oil and drinking water separators, Kleanland esp be sure that exhaust gases are treated comprehensively in advance of becoming produced to the atmosphere. This extensive strategy tends to make them a significant ingredient in modern textile production amenities, assisting providers comply with stringent environmental restrictions.
